David Nalbandian to undergo hip surgery

Argentine tennis star David Nalbandian is set to undergo hip surgery next week. This could sideline the former world number three for four to six months, thereby missing lucrative tennis tournaments such as the French Open (May), Wimbledon (June) and Davis Cup (July).

Nalbandian said in an interview with an Argentinian sports channel this week that his right hip is constantly bothering him for the past few weeks. On Tuesday, the 19th ranked player lost to Chile’s Paul Capdeville in the first round of Estoril Open.

The former Wimbledon runner-up was expected to team up with compatriot Juan Martin del Potro at the Davis Cup quarterfinals which will be held in Czech Republic this July.
